pastilhasandClaude Opus 5 30052e3295 port the firewall, last, and bind the Docker rules to the real interface
Last in the run for the reason the original gave: enabling a firewall is the one
step that can cut the connection it is running over.

The security bug is in the shipped rules. ufw-docker-rules.conf hardcodes eth0 in
all three of its rules. Docker publishes container ports by writing its own
iptables rules underneath ufw — DOCKER-USER is the hook that lets ufw have a say
at all — so on a machine with predictable interface names (ens18, enp1s0, most
VPS images) none of those rules match, the final DROP never fires, and every
published port is open to the internet while `ufw status` reports active. A
firewall that says it is working and is not is worse than no firewall. The rules
are now substituted with the interface the machine actually uses, verified by
applying them against a stubbed ens18.

Order inside the section is the other thing that matters: OpenSSH is allowed
BEFORE anything is enabled, unconditionally, because a firewall enabled without
an ssh rule on a machine reached over ssh needs a console to fix. The prompt says
so, and says to open a second session before closing the current one.

tailscale0 is checked and offered, because the default is deny inbound and the
tailnet is an inbound interface like any other — without that rule Officer is
unreachable over the tailnet while Tailscale reports itself connected.
